Hodges, Gibson recognized for service to City of Cleveland

Jerry Hodges, who works in the City of Cleveland's Public Works Department, is recognized by Cleveland City Manager Kelly McDonald for his 25 years of service to the city. Hodges and Cleveland Police Department Administrative Asst. Cynthia Gibson (not pictured) were congratulated at the Nov. 19 Cleveland City Council meeting.
